Both prophecies of Revelation and Joel
tells of creatures having power to injure
but not kill.
"And to them it was given that they should
not kill them but that they should be torm-
ented five months; and their torment was
as the torment of a scorpion when he
striketh a man." Revelation 9:5
The prophecy in Joel, declares that these
creatures shall cause much pain, but they
are not said to kill.
"Before their face the people shall be much
pained: all faces shall gather blackness."
Joel 2:6
Both prophecies in Revelation and Joel
tells of spirit-creatures.
Though the locusts were demons "like
unto horses", they were not actual horses.
They were spirit-beings that came out of
the Bottomless Pit.
The prophecy in Joel, refers to the non-
natural nature. Ordinary horses or locusts
can be killed. These evil creature couldn't
be wounded in Joel 2:8.
Also, they have power to climb walls, run
upon them, enter windows, which ordinary
horses can't do Joel 2:7-9.

Both prophecies in Revelation and Joel
tells of creatures like horses. These locust-
demons are like unto horses prepared for
battle. "And the shapes of the locusts were
like unto horses prepared for battle."
Revelation 9:7
The prophecy of Joel tells of strange creat-
ures with the appearance of horses. " The
appearance of them is as the appearance
of horses: and as horsemen, so shall they
run." Joel 2:4

Both prophecies in Revelation and Joel
refer to locust-like creatures.
The Fifth Trumpet has demon-locusts
coming out of the Bottomless Pit. They
are similar to locusts but they are not
literal locusts. "And there came out of
the smoke, locusts upon the earth; and
unto them was given power, as scorp-
ions of the earth had power."
Revelation 9:3
The prophecy of Joel 2 tells of an army
of creatures which came upon the land
that act like locusts, but they are not
literal locusts.

Both prophecies in Revelation and Joel
speak of a day of darkness. . .
The Day of the Lord is introduced with
the darkening of the sun and moon. The
Fourth Trumpet, before the Fifth Trumpet
was the same. "The third part of the sun
was smitten, and the third part of the
moon, and the third part of the stars; so
as the third part of them was darkened."
Revelation 8:12
The Fifth Trumpet has a darkening of
the sun by the smoke from the Bottom-
less Pit. Revelation 9:2 And the prophecy
of Joel 2:2 also speaks of this day of
darkness.

Both prophecies in Revelation 6:12-17
and Joel 2:10 speaks of an earthquake.
The Day of the Lord as shown in Revelation,
begins with an earthquake, the darkening
of the sun and the moon, the shaking of the
heavens, and the falling of the stars from
heaven.
The prophecy in Joel is preceded by an
earthquake, the darkening of the sun and the
moon and the stars.

Both prophecies of Revelation and Joel were
fulfilled during the Day of the Lord. The time
for the appearance of this judgment mention-
ed in Joel is right.
The Fifth Trumpet come shortly after the
beginning of the Day of the Lord. Revelation
6:16-17 The second chapter of Joel starts
with the statement, "the day of the Lord
cometh, for it is nigh at hand."

" And they had a king over them, which is
the angel of the bottomless pit, whose name
in the Hebrew tongue is Abaddon, but in
the Greek tongue hath his name Apollyon."
Revelation 9:11
Abaddon or Apollyon is a subordinate
prince under the rule of Satan. Satan has
many demon angels under him [Matthew
25:41].
Satan has princes who have power to resist
the missions of the righteous angels.
[Daniel 10:13].

This judgment of the locusts is to continue
for five months. Revelation 9:10 " And they
had tails like unto scorpions, and there were
stings in their tails: and their power was to
hurt men five months."
It is the same length of time that the flood
lasted [Genesis 7:24]. And about the length
of time natural locusts appear - May thru
September.
This Judgment is the first of three "woes".

The Bottomless Pit or Abyss is not the
same as the Lake of Fire.
The Bottomless Pit is a prison. Demons
plead with Jesus not to send them to that
place [Luke 8:31]. The Beast of Revlelation
17, comes up out of the Bottomless Pit.
And now these demon-locusts arise from
the opened Pit as a swarm of evil creatures
from hell. Evil creatures are held there for
a particular period of time and are released
when that time is up, to do some particular
reason or purpose.
Satan is bound in the Bottomless Pit dur-
ing the Millennium [1000 years], but
will be let out at the end for a little while
longer to test the nations. Revelation 20:7-9
